Paynesville, Minn. – The Paynesville Area Community Foundation (PACF) is opening their general grant round on February 1st, 2023. It will close at 11:59 p.m., March 31, 2023. 

Eligible organizations must be a 501(c)3 nonprofit organization, school or government entity who serve residents within the Paynesville Area school district including Regal, Lake Henry and Roscoe.

PACF will focus its grant making primarily on applications from organizations providing service in the areas of:

  • Education
  • Social Services
  • Arts and Culture
  • Civic
  • Recreational
  • Health

Favorable considerations are programs that make a sustainable positive impact in the community and build or support collaborative efforts that involve other community partners such as other nonprofits, government entities, businesses and citizen groups. Also, initiatives likely to make a difference in the quality of life and have the potential to inspire additional investments in the community, will be considered. The Paynesville Area Community Foundation (PACF), a partner of the Central Minnesota Community Foundation and powered by CommunityGiving, is a public charity that attracts and administers charitable funds for the benefit of the local community.  PACF has grown to over $4.8 million in assets and awarded over $922,000 in grants to the community.  Collectively, CommunityGiving administers over 1,000 funds totaling nearly $195 million.
